Coverage rankings for Alamance County, NC

Verizon currently ranks first for coverage in this area, with a coverage score of 91.3. Compare Wireless Carriers uses FCC broadband map data to estimate and calculate coverage scores. More on that further below.

RankCarrierScoreOverall4G LTE5GFast 5GAverage Signal
1Verizon91.399.7%99.7%89.9%75.6% -99 dBm
2T-Mobile80.884.0%83.9%76.9%56.8% -91 dBm
3AT&T66.297.5%97.5%35.4%23.8% -109 dBm

Scores include coverage area, network type, and average signal strength.

About The Coverage Data

Coverage and signal estimates are derived by Compare Wireless Carriers from carrier-reported data in the FCC’s National Broadband Coverage Map, last updated in June 2025. “Percent covered” shows how much of the city or ZIP code area has a carrier signal, whether weak or strong. Signal bars show the estimated average signal strength in areas of Alamance County, NC where that carrier has coverage.

If a carrier says you should have service but you do not, run a challenge test with the FCC Mobile Speed Test App. The FCC uses those results to check carrier-submitted coverage data and requires a carrier response when enough tests show a pattern of inaccurate coverage reporting.
